Design Your Own Feet

As our learning this week and next is focussed around Bonfire Night and Diwali, Eileen, our Family Learning Co-ordinator, organised an activity linked to these celebrations.
As Hindus welcome Lakshmi, the goddess of wealth and prosperity, into their homes at Diwali, her tiny footprints are found around the house to show her arrival. The children drew round their feet and produced some wonderfully creative and individual designs on their drawings to represent Lakshmi.
They also worked with their families to make chocolate sparklers which seemed to go down just as well as the sparklers at a bonfire.
